What is the origin of the last name Brugnago?

The last name Brugnago is of Italian origin. It is believed to be of toponymic origin, derived from the name of the town of Brugnago in the Lombardy region of northern Italy. Toponymic surnames are derived from the name of a place where the original bearer of the surname lived or owned land. Therefore, the surname Brugnago likely indicates that the original bearer was from or had some connection to the town of Brugnago.

The meaning and origin of the last name Brugnago

The surname Brugnago is of Italian origin and is derived from the name of the town Brugnago in the Lombardy region of Italy. The name Brugnago is believed to be derived from the Lombardic word "brugo," meaning "swamp" or "marsh," and the suffix "-ago," indicating a place or location. Therefore, the surname Brugnago likely originally referred to someone who lived near or worked in the vicinity of a marshy area. Over time, individuals with this surname may have migrated from the town of Brugnago to other regions, leading to the spread of the name. Today, individuals with the surname Brugnago can be found in various parts of Italy and potentially around the world, carrying on the legacy of their ancestral ties to the town of Brugnago.

Geographical distribution of the last name Brugnago

The last name Brugnago is primarily found in the northern regions of Italy, specifically in the Veneto and Lombardy regions. The surname has a relatively low prevalence in the country, with a small number of individuals bearing this name scattered across various provinces and towns in these regions. Due to the historical origins of the name, it is more commonly found in rural areas and smaller towns rather than in larger urban centers. The name Brugnago may also be found in other countries with Italian diaspora communities, such as the United States, Canada, and Argentina, where individuals with Italian heritage have settled over the years. Overall, the geographical distribution of the last name Brugnago is limited to certain regions of Italy with a small presence in select countries abroad.
